Current Students With Disabilities

Title II of the Americans With Disabilities Act (1990) and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act (1973) were designed to prevent discrimination against individuals with disabilities. To comply with this legislation, Monroe County Community College has developed a non-discrimination policy and guideline Services for Persons With Disabilities.

 

WHAT IS A DISABILITY?
The Americans With Disabilities Act specifies that a person with a disability is one who:

  • Has a physical or mental impairment which substantially limits one or more major life activity;
  • Has a record of such an impairment; or,
  • Is regarded as having such an impairment.

Learning is a major life activity. Students may have specific learning disabilities that affect their progress in learning. Students may have other disabling conditions that affect their access to the classroom and instruction. Each type of disability may be addressed with a specific accommodation.

Accommodations for Students With Disabilities are designed to "level the playing field," making it possible for students with disabilities to take advantage of the opportunities for learning all students at Monroe County Community College enjoy.

HOW CAN A CURRENT MONROE COUNTY COMMUNITY COLLEGE STUDENT WITH A DISABILITY ACCESS SERVICES?

The first step in obtaining services as a student with a disability at the College is to make an appointment with a counselor in the Learning Assistance Lab (LAL) (734)384-4167. The LAL is the office at Monroe County Community College that provides Services for Students with Disabilities.

All services are provided by counselors specially trained to follow the law and to assist persons with disabilities in gaining access to classes, College programs, and campus activities. Any student with a disability is free do discuss his or her disability with an instructor. However, a student should meet with one of the LAL Disability Services Counselors first. Students who need accommodations on tests or quizzes need to use the established Disability Services test request procedures.
